Setting Up GroupDocs.Signature for Java

To begin using GroupDocs.Signature, you need to set it up in your project. Here’s how you can add it via Maven or Gradle:

Maven

Include the following dependency in your pom.xml file:

<dependency>
    <groupId>com.groupdocs</groupId>
    <artifactId>groupdocs-signature</artifactId>
    <version>23.12</version>
</dependency>

Gradle

Add this line to your build.gradle file:

implementation 'com.groupdocs:groupdocs-signature:23.12'

Searching for Metadata Signatures in Images

Overview

The primary goal here is to search an image document for existing metadata signatures. This capability allows developers to programmatically access and utilize embedded metadata efficiently.

Step 1: Import Required Classes

Begin by importing the necessary classes from the GroupDocs.Signature library:

import com.groupdocs.signature.Signature;
import com.groupdocs.signature.domain.enums.SignatureType;
import com.groupdocs.signature.domain.signatures.metadata.ImageMetadataSignature;
Step 2: Initialize Signature Object

As shown earlier, create a Signature object with your image file path.

Step 3: Search for Metadata Signatures

Use the search method to find metadata signatures within the document:

List<ImageMetadataSignature> signatures = signature.search(ImageMetadataSignature.class, SignatureType.Metadata);

This retrieves all metadata signatures present in the specified image document.

Step 4: Find Specific Metadata by ID

To filter and retrieve specific metadata based on an ID:

double imgsMetadataId = 41997;

try {
    ImageMetadataSignature mdSignature = firstOrDefault(signatures, imgsMetadataId);
    
    if (mdSignature != null) {
        System.out.println("[" + mdSignature.getId() + "] as String = " + mdSignature.toString());
    }
} catch (Exception e) {
    e.printStackTrace();
}

The firstOrDefault method checks for the presence of a signature with the specified ID and returns it if found.
